A Life Too Short, But Full of Meaning
Liang was like any other boy smart, inquisitive, and ambitious. Yet at the age of 9, he was diagnosed with terminal brain cancer. Even after treatment, his health was declining, and by the time he was 11, the doctors had little more hope left.
But Liang did not let his illness conquer him. Rather, he did something that would shock the world.
The Choice That Shocked Everyone
One day, Liang informed his family and physicians that he wished to donate his organs after his passing.
These were his own words, plain yet powerful:
"I can be a teacher. This way, many people will remember me."
Donating his organs wasn't merely saving lives in his mind it was giving even after he had run out of time on Earth.
At only 11, he knew something many adults are still trying to understand: that greatness is achieved through giving.
The Last Farewell
On June 6, 2014, Liang Yaoyi passed away after his fight against brain cancer. But in death, he kept his word. His organs were selectively harvested and donated, saving the lives of several patients.
In that instant, the hospital room was silent. Doctors and nurses who have witnessed death daily were brought to tears. As Liang's little body was taken away, they did something remarkable:
They bowed in unison, deeply, in respect for him for the hero he had become.
It was an instant of pure humanity a roomful of adults showing respect to a child whose bravery outweighed his age.
